From the 6th to 7th of February 2024, the LUCRA partners met in the beautiful city of Madrid (Spain) for their second project meeting in Month 8 of the project. The meeting was organized by the project partner FCC Medio Ambiente and took place in their headquarters in Las Tablas, Madrid.

During the one-and-a-half-day meeting, LUCRA partners presented the achievements and progress of the different work packages. The consortium discussed the next steps, upcoming actions and future activities. In the afternoon of the first day, all participants had the opportunity to visit the biomethanisation plant „Las Dehesas“ outside of Madrid, learning about the pretreatment process of the organic fractions of municipal solid waste (OFMSW) to generate prehydrolysates. The process starts  with removal of the plastic waste and grinding of the organic waste fraction. In the project‘s value chain a hydrolysis process takes place to release the nutrients and sugars in the biomass to make them available for the fermentation step.

The optimization of the organic biowaste collection, storage and supply is a main project objective as well as the optimization of the hydrolysis process. This will be further investigated by the LUCRA partners.

The consortium visited the biomethanisation plant “Las Dehesas”, which produces biogas and compost from municipal organic waste from the Madrid city.

The second day of the meeting included several work package presentations and break-out sessions to allow discussions between the partners of the individual work packages.

In July 2023, the first phase of the four-year Circular Bio-based Europe Joint Undertaking (CBE JU) Project LUCRA kicked-off in Ghent. LUCRA aims to demonstrate a unique process to convert underutilized organic fraction of municipal solid waste (OFMSW) and wood waste into bio-based succinic acid.
